Time Breakdown

  • Preparation Time: 10 minutes
  • Cooking Time: 25 minutes
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Servings: 4

Ingredients List for Roasted Carrots with Whipped Ricotta and Hot Honey

  • 4 large carrots
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ground coriander
  • 1/4 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/2 cup ricotta cheese
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ped

How To Make Roasted Carrots with Whipped Ricotta and Hot Honey Step-by-Step

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C).

Step 2: Prepare the Carrots

Peel the carrots and cut them into evenly sized pieces, either in half or quarters depending on their thickness.

Step 3: Arrange on Baking Sheet

Place the carrot pieces on a baking sheet.

Step 4: Add Olive Oil

Drizzle the olive oil over the carrots.

Step 5: Season the Carrots

Sprinkle the salt, black pepper, ground cumin, ground coriander, and smoked paprika evenly over the carrots.

Step 6: Toss the Carrots

Toss the carrots to ensure they are coated in the oil and seasonings.

Step 7: Spread on Baking Sheet

Spread the carrots out in a single layer on the baking sheet.

Step 8: Roast the Carrots

Roast the carrots in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until they are tender and lightly browned, flipping halfway through for even roasting.

Step 9: Prepare Whipped Ricotta

While the carrots are roasting, prepare the whipped ricotta. In a medium bowl, add the ricotta cheese.

Step 10: Whip the Ricotta

Using a spoon or a hand mixer, whip the ricotta until it becomes smooth and creamy.

Step 11: Mix in Honey

Drizzle in the honey while continuing to whip the ricotta, ensuring it is fully incorporated.

Step 12: Add Flavor

Add the red pepper flakes and lemon juice to the whipped ricotta, mixing until well combined.

Step 13: Assemble the Dish

Once the carrots are roasted, remove them from the oven and allow them to cool slightly.

Step 14: Plate the Ricotta

Spread the whipped ricotta mixture evenly on a serving platter.

Step 15: Top with Carrots

Top the ricotta with the roasted carrots.

Step 16: Drizzle Honey

Drizzle any leftover honey over the carrots for added sweetness.

Step 17: Garnish

Garnish with fresh chopped parsley.

Step 18: Serve

Serve immediately and enjoy your roasted carrots with whipped ricotta and hot honey.

Chef’s Notes & Pro Tips About Roasted Carrots with Whipped Ricotta and Hot Honey

  1. Carrot Size Matters: Try to cut your carrots to uniform sizes to ensure even roasting and tenderness.
  2. Honey Choice: Use a high-quality honey for better flavor; the taste will greatly enhance the dish.
  3. Fresh Herbs: Don’t hesitate to add other fresh herbs like basil or thyme for an extra layer of flavor.
  4. Incorporate Nuts: For added crunch, sprinkle some toasted walnuts or pecans on top of the carrots before serving.
  5. Adjust Heat: To make it spicier, increase the amount of red pepper flakes, or try different hot sauces drizzled on top.

How To Store Roasted Carrots with Whipped Ricotta and Hot Honey

  1. Refrigerate Promptly: Store leftover roasted carrots in an airtight container in the fridge within two hours of serving.
  2. Use Within 3 Days: For the best taste and texture, consume within three days of preparation.
  3. Separate Components: If possible, store the whipped ricotta and roasted carrots separately to maintain freshness.
  4. Reheat Gently: When reheating, do so in the oven or microwave for just a few seconds until warm.
  5. Avoid Freezing: Freezing is not recommended, as the ricotta will change texture when thawed.

FAQs About Roasted Carrots with Whipped Ricotta and Hot Honey

  1. Can I use baby carrots for this recipe?
    Yes, baby carrots work well! Just adjust the cooking time as needed.

  2. Is there a substitute for ricotta cheese?
    You can use cream cheese or Greek yogurt as alternatives, but adjust the flavorings accordingly.

  3. Can I make this recipe ahead of time?
    You can roast the carrots ahead of time, but it’s best to whip the ricotta just before serving.

  4. How spicy is this dish?
    The heat level can be adjusted easily by varying the amount of red pepper flakes or honey used.
